Indigo production at BASF in 1890
BASF was set up in 1865 to produce other chemicals necessary for dye production, notably soda and acids.
In 1866 the dye production processes were also moved to the BASF site.
The development of the Haber process from 1908 to 1912 made it possible to synthesize ammonia ( a major industrial chemical as the primary source of nitrogen ), and, after acquiring exclusive rights to the process, in 1913 BASF started a new production plant in Oppau, adding fertilizers to its product range.
